Reformation: Further Streams

October 31, 2017 marks 500 years since Martin Luther posted the "Ninety-Five Theses" on the Wittenberg door, igniting the Protestant Reformation. All this month at Regent Audio, we'll be highlighting the very best resources we have to help you think through the background and consequences of this watershed moment in Christian history.

This week we're focusing on some of the other streams of Reformation impact: the Anglicans, Anabaptists, and Catholicism.
